Spazzle posted:I mean, it probably is divided like this? Not exactly. 28% of US land belongs to the Federal Government, so right off the bat there's a big chunk that doesn't fit in. Outside of that, there's not really that much connection between wealth distribution and land distribution. A lot of the most lucrative businesses aren't really land-intensive, so a lot of land use gets eaten up by less lucrative things like lumber, pastures, and crops (and with crops, there's still often a lack of relation between area and value, places like California and Hawaii can squeeze a whole lot more value out of smaller areas with cash crops compared to the midwest's endless tracts of corn). There are a definitely few giant landowners gobbling up big chunks of the land, but I don't think it's quite as bad as wealth distribution. It also doesn't come up much, because people talk more about the comparatively tiny amount of urban land usage, and much less about national parks, and much much less about logging. Big agricultural landowners are very politically important in their local areas, but their relevancy drops steeply the further you get from heavily rural areas so there's not many people to talk about it.
